This episode of the podcast explores the profound Jewish spiritual principle of 'enjoying life' as a core mitzvah, not merely a luxury. The host opens with a powerful parable about a man running to claim land, only to die exhausted and buried in six feet—highlighting the futility of chasing material goals while neglecting the present moment. The central message is that life is a journey to be savored, not just a destination to reach. The host emphasizes that true fulfillment comes from enjoying the process of striving toward goals, not just the achievement itself. Drawing from Torah, Talmud, and real-life stories—including a janitor who bought a red Mustang at 75 to live joyfully, and a man whose stress ruined his family until he learned to appreciate the journey—the episode argues that effort counts in God’s eyes, and that every day, every challenge, and every small act of growth is valuable. The discussion extends to the importance of positive self-talk, motivation, and the dangers of living trapped in the past or anxious about the future. The host concludes with a call to live fully in the present, recognizing that each second is a divine gift to be used wisely, joyfully, and with gratitude.

The Tragedy of Living in the Past
The host warns against being trapped in past failures, trauma, or regrets. He shares a story of a woman who focused on her husband’s past flaws until she learned to focus on the present and rebuild her marriage.
The Future Trap and the Gift of Now
The episode critiques people who live only in the future—worrying about retirement, money, or tomorrow—while ignoring the present. The host emphasizes that every second is a divine gift to be used wisely.
